Understanding the Sri Lankan Market
Before diving into the intricacies of the property management business, it’s crucial to understand Sri Lanka’s unique market. Known as the ‘Pearl of the Indian Ocean’, Sri Lanka is a favored holiday destination, popular for its beautiful landscapes, diverse fauna and flora, historical artifacts, and world-renowned tea. Recent trends also indicate a rise in digital nomads seeking short and long-term stays. Your property management goals should align with these aspects, offering experiences tailored for tourists and working professionals alike.
Embrace the Local Culture
Absorbing the local culture is a trending theme among travelers. It’s not just about the stay anymore; it’s about experiencing the local lifestyle, traditions, and food. So, weave the essence of Sri Lanka into your property. Add touches of traditional Sri Lankan aesthetics to your home décor – from handmade batik to local art pieces. Think about organising traditional cookery classes, tea tasting experiences or arranging for local dance performances – anything that offers a taste of the local culture.
Go Green
Sri Lanka’s biodiversity is one of its biggest attractions. Showcasing eco-friendliness in your Airbnb property management strategy can attract guests who appreciate sustainability. You can introduce methods like solar power usage, water conservation, waste management, and sourcing locally produced items, etc. Emphasising your green credentials in your property description could set you apart from the competition.

Leverage Technology for Efficiency
Investing in technology can help you achieve operational efficiency in managing your Airbnb property. Use property management software to automate tasks such as booking management, guest communication, invoicing, etc. It can help you save time and minimize errors. Also, consider smart home technologies like keyless entry or smart thermostats to enhance guests’ convenience and safety.

Regulatory Compliance
Understanding and adherging to the local regulations related to short-term rentals is vital. This may include acquiring necessary permits, paying taxes, observing noise ordinances, and respecting housing laws and associations’ rules. Keeping compliant will ensure a smooth operation and protect your business from potential legal issues.

Understanding & Balancing Pricing
Setting competitive pricing could attract more bookings, but it should also cover your expenses and make the business profitable. Consider dynamically managing your prices to account for peak tourist seasons, local events, or other factors. Tools like Airbnb’s pricing tips or external yield management tools can aid you in this.
